Business Owner? Add your logo and more… Claim
Gift Shops in Ormskirk
Be the first to review
13 Aughton StreetOrmskirkLancashireL39 3BH
Show map
01695 5... 01695 579 251
There are currently no reviews for this company
All fields are required. Your review will appear immediately.
By leaving this review, you agree with our Terms of membership
Similar nearby businesses
1 Church View Court, Ormskirk, L39 2YH
6 West View, Ormskirk, L39 2DJ
Cedar Farm Galleries, Ormskirk, L40 3SY
84 New Court Way, Ormskirk, L39 2YT
6 Burscough Street, Ormskirk, L39 2ER
The Market Hall, Ormskirk, L39 4RT